Here are the first few standards and resources:
4.1 Describe the legacy and cultures of the major indigenous settlements in Tennessee including
the Paleo, Archaic, Woodland, and Mississippian: (C, G, TN)
• Coats-Hines Site
• Pinson Mounds
• Old Stone Fort
• Chucalissa Indian Village
4.2 Analyze religious beliefs, customs, and various folklore traditions of the Cherokee, Creek,
and Chickasaw, including: (C, TN)
• Principal Chief
• summer and winter homes
• Beloved Woman
• recreation
• clans
• maternal designations
4.3 Create a visual display using multiple forms of media to identify with pictures geographic
terms including bluffs, swamps, isthmus, gulf, sea, bay, and cape. (G)
4.4 Trace the routes of early explorers and describe the early explorations of the Americas,
including: (C, E, G, H, P, TN)
• Christopher Columbus
• Ferdinand Magellan
• Amerigo Vespucci
• Robert de La Salle
• Hernando de Soto
• Henry Hudson
• Jacques Cartier
